#d9664d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d9664d is composed of 85.1% red, 40%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53% magenta, 64.5%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 10.7 degrees, a saturation of 64.8% and a lightness of 57.6%. #d9664d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ffcc9a with #b30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#d9664d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#d9664d has RGB values of R:217, G:102,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.53, Y:0.65,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14247501.

Hex triplet d9664d #d9664d
RGB Decimal 217, 102, 77 rgb(217,102,77)
RGB Percent 85.1, 40, 30.2 rgb(85.1%,40%,30.2%)
CMYK 0, 53, 65, 15
HSL 10.7°, 64.8, 57.6 hsl(10.7,64.8%,57.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 10.7°, 64.5, 85.1
Web Safe cc6666 #cc6666
CIE-LAB 56.874, 43.27, 35.473
XYZ 34.707, 24.793, 9.979
xyY 0.5, 0.357, 24.793
CIE-LCH 56.874, 55.952, 39.345
CIE-LUV 56.874, 88.854, 31.656
Hunter-Lab 49.793, 37.282, 22.973
Binary 11011001, 01100110, 01001101

Shades and Tints of #d9664d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100603 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#d9664d is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#868686 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#97807b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#9a8e61 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#ad884f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#dc6a70 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#b17f5a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#bd7b4e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#db6863 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
